Advanced Carbon Road Wheels for High-Performance Cycling
Carbon road wheels represent a major upgrade for cyclists seeking improved speed, efficiency, and ride quality. Engineered with high-modulus carbon fiber and advanced aerodynamic profiles, they deliver exceptional stiffness, lower weight, and smoother power transfer. Whether used for competitive racing, intense training, or long-distance endurance rides, carbon wheels significantly elevate overall performance.
One of the defining advantages of carbon road wheels is their lightweight structure. Carbon fiber reduces rotational mass, allowing cyclists to accelerate faster, climb more efficiently, and maintain higher speeds with less effort. This reduction in weight also enhances agility, making the wheels feel more responsive during sprints, tight cornering, and sudden changes in pace. Riders experience faster transitions and improved handling, especially in challenging terrain.
Aerodynamics are another core feature of modern carbon wheels. Deeper rim profiles are carefully shaped to cut through airflow, minimizing drag and reducing turbulence around the wheel. This streamlined design offers significant benefits in flat sections, time trials, and high-speed descents. Even shallower rims deliver improved airflow, offering a balanced option for riders who need stability in windy conditions without sacrificing speed.
Stiffness and power transfer are key performance factors. Carbon construction improves lateral and torsional stiffness, ensuring that more of a cyclist’s pedaling energy is converted into forward motion. This results in better responsiveness during climbs and sprints, as well as increased stability when navigating technical routes or uneven road surfaces. The enhanced stiffness also improves braking performance when paired with modern disc brake systems, offering stronger, more consistent stopping power.
Comfort is not compromised, despite the stiffness. Carbon fiber naturally dampens vibrations, reducing road buzz and helping riders maintain comfort during long rides. This makes carbon wheels an excellent choice for endurance cyclists who spend extended hours on the saddle. The improved ride smoothness reduces fatigue, allowing for better overall performance and longer sustained efforts.
Durability has also become a hallmark of modern carbon wheel designs. Advanced resin systems, reinforced spoke beds, and impact-resistant layups provide increased strength and resilience. Today’s carbon wheels are engineered to withstand rough roads, cobblestones, and high-intensity riding without compromising structural integrity. With proper maintenance, they offer long-lasting reliability.
Tubeless compatibility adds another layer of performance. Many carbon road wheels are designed to support tubeless tires, which offer lower rolling resistance, better puncture protection, and enhanced comfort. Riders can run lower pressures for improved traction and cornering control while reducing the risk of pinch flats.
Overall, carbon road wheels deliver a combination of lightweight agility, aerodynamic efficiency, stiffness, and comfort that far surpasses traditional alloy wheels. They are a premium investment for cyclists seeking top-tier performance across varied riding conditions. Whether sprinting, climbing, or cruising at high speeds, carbon wheels provide a noticeable and transformative improvement in ride quality and competitive capability.
